Shrimp and Spinach Pasta Rolls (Print View)

Tender pasta filled with shrimp, spinach, and ricotta, topped with a creamy roasted red pepper sauce.

# What You'll Need:

→ Filling

01 - 8 to 10 lasagna noodles, cooked al dente
02 - 1 tablespoon olive oil
03 - 2 cloves garlic, minced
04 - 0.5 pound shrimp, peeled, deveined, chopped
05 - 2 cups fresh spinach, roughly chopped
06 - 1.5 cups ricotta cheese
07 - 0.5 cup grated Parmesan cheese
08 - 1 large egg
09 - 1 tablespoon fresh parsley or basil, chopped
10 - Salt and black pepper, to taste
11 - Pinch of red pepper flakes (optional)

→ Roasted Red Pepper Cream Sauce

12 - 1 tablespoon olive oil
13 - 2 cloves garlic, minced
14 - 1 jar roasted red peppers, drained (about 12 ounces)
15 - 0.5 cup heavy cream
16 - 0.25 cup grated Parmesan cheese
17 - Salt and black pepper, to taste
18 - 1 teaspoon lemon juice or white wine (optional)

# Directions:

01 -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Sauté garlic for 30 seconds, then add shrimp and cook until pink, about 2 to 3 minutes. Add spinach and cook until wilted. Season with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es if desired. Remove from heat and allow the mixture to cool slightly.
02 - In a large bowl, mix ricotta, Parmesan, egg, chopped herbs, and the cooled shrimp-spinach mixture. Stir until creamy and thoroughly combined.
03 - Heat olive oil in a saucepan and sauté garlic for 30 seconds. Add roasted red peppers and cook for 2 minutes. Transfer peppers and garlic to a blender with heavy cream and Parmesan; blend until smooth. Return the sauce to the saucepan, season with salt, pepper, and lemon juice or white wine if desired. Warm through gently.
04 - Lay out the cooked lasagna noodles. Place 2 to 3 tablespoons of the filling onto each noodle and roll gently. Arrange the rolls seam-side down in a greased baking dish.
05 - Pour the roasted red pepper cream sauce over the rolls. Cover the baking dish with foil and bake at 375°F for 20 minutes. Remove foil and continue baking for 10 minutes until bubbly and golden.
06 - Sprinkle the baked rolls with extra Parmesan, fresh herbs, or a dash of chili flakes if desired. Serve warm accompanied by garlic bread or a crisp salad.

# Notes:

01 - Allow the shrimp-spinach filling to cool before combining with dairy to prevent curdling.
02 - For best results, use no-boil lasagna noodles only if specified, as regular noodles provide better texture when rolled.
